#667f8d Color Information

In a RGB color space, hex #667f8d is composed of 40% red, 49.8% green and 55.3%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 27.7% cyan, 9.9% magenta, 0% yellow and 44.7% black. It has a hue angle of 201.5 degrees, a saturation of 16% and a lightness of 47.6%. #667f8d color hex could be obtained by blending #ccfeff with #00001b. Closest websafe color is: #666699.

#667f8d Color Conversion

The hexadecimal color #667f8d has RGB values of R:102, G:127, B:141 and CMYK values of C:0.28, M:0.1, Y:0, K:0.45. Its decimal value is 6717325.

Hex triplet 667f8d #667f8d
RGB Decimal 102, 127, 141 rgb(102,127,141)
RGB Percent 40, 49.8, 55.3 rgb(40%,49.8%,55.3%)
CMYK 28, 10, 0, 45
HSL 201.5°, 16, 47.6 hsl(201.5,16%,47.6%)
HSV (or HSB) 201.5°, 27.7, 55.3
Web Safe 666699 #666699
CIE-LAB 51.754, -5.573, -10.521
XYZ 17.875, 19.926, 28.102
xyY 0.271, 0.302, 19.926
CIE-LCH 51.754, 11.906, 242.091
CIE-LUV 51.754, -13.162, -14.263
Hunter-Lab 44.639, -6.637, -6.079
Binary 01100110, 01111111, 10001101

Shades and Tints of #667f8d

A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#030404 is the darkest color, while #f8f9fa is the lightest one.
